Plugin Description

Turn your content into campaigns

Connect your WordPress site to emBlue and automatically turn the posts you publish into email newsletters, sent to your lists on the schedule you choose. No copying and pasting content into an email editor every week.

With this plugin you can:

  • Automate daily and weekly newsletters built from your latest posts, choosing the days and the time of the send. Both frequencies can run at once, each with its own list, campaign and subject.
  • Decide what gets included, filtering by category, excluding the ones you do not want to send, and setting a minimum number of posts so an empty newsletter never goes out.
  • Control the subject line, either fixed or built dynamically from the title of your first or last post.
  • Grow your contacts with a subscription form you can place anywhere using the [emblue_subscription] shortcode or the included widget. New subscribers are added to the emBlue list you select.
  • Keep your own design, using the built-in templates or a custom template placed in your theme folder.
  • Send in several languages, with a separate list, campaign and subject per language on multilingual sites.
  • Review every send from the log tab in the admin, which records what was sent and when.

Requirements

You need an emBlue account. The plugin sends your content through the emBlue platform, so it does not work on its own — see the External Services section below for what data is sent and when.

Scheduled sends rely on WP-Cron. On low traffic sites, configure a real system cron calling wp-cron.php so the newsletters go out on time.

Caching

The subscription form requests a fresh security nonce from admin-ajax.php on each submit, so it works with full-page caching (WP Rocket, LiteSpeed Cache, Cloudflare, etc.) without excluding pages from the cache.

External Services

This plugin connects to the emBlue API to manage contacts and mailing lists. This connection is required for the plugin to function.

What data is sent and when:
– The subscriber’s email address is sent to the emBlue API when a visitor submits the subscription form on your site.
– No data is sent until a user actively subscribes.
